Hatching a Rex egg in the north.
Hey everyone, so I am currently trying to hatch my rex eggs in the north. I have like 4 AC untis setup but when I drop the egg next to it, it says its still to cold. Do I need more AC units or a metal room?

Gnollmar 17/out./2015 às 15:19 
1 ac = +- 4 celsius. rex egg needs 30-35 C, in the north, you would need to use an amount of AC's depending on this.

What is the lowest temperature in your area?

Do ((30 - lowest) / 4), round it upwards, this is youer minimum amount of AC's to ensure your rex egg wont die out. If you want it at night too, the expect a lot more AC's.
Gravelsack 17/out./2015 às 15:19 
I have hatched several Rex eggs in the snow biome. 7 ac units with a catwalk above them to place the egg on, and 2 standing torches to light when nighttime temperatures dip.
